Patent application number | Description | Published |
20080229089 | Remote network device provisioning - Various embodiments are disclosed relating to remote network device provisioning. A method is disclosed, the method comprising discovering a network address associated with a device on a network based on a discovery response received in response to a discovery request provided to the device. One or more configurable boot options associated with the device may be determined based at least in part on the discovery response. One or more of the configurable boot options may be configured on the device, wherein, upon reboot of the device using the configured boot options, a software image is provided to the device. | 09-18-2008 |
20080235363 | METHOD AND SYSTEM FOR PLATFORM LEVEL DATA MODEL FOR INDICATIONS BASED EVENT CONTROL AND DATA TRANSFER - For a platform level data model for indications based event control and data transfer, a management controller may enable performing indications based management operations that may be based on a management service utilizing CIM Indications model. The management controller may enable communication of indications based messaging and/or data. The indications may be triggered based on events generated and/or triggered in a plurality of managed entities. The events generation may be performed dynamically within the plurality of managed entities, or may be initiated via the management controller. The management controller may enable processing of partially generated indications, via the plurality of managed entities, and/or as pass-through router for full indications processed via the plurality of managed entities. The indications based management operations may also comprise subscription related operations wherein the management controller may enable performing processing of subscription requests, modifications, and/or deletions to facilitate external access via the device. | 09-25-2008 |
20080263191 | METHOD AND SYSTEM FOR HANDLING PACKET FILTERING INFORMATION - A portion of management traffic, carried via network traffic, and received and/or transmitted via a network controller, may be processed externally to the network controller, wherein management messaging may be carried via network packets, and one or more headers may added to enable transmission and/or reception via the network controller. Packet filters may be setup, in the network controller, via the management controller, to enable determining network packets that may carry the management traffic. The management controller may utilize commands to setup packet filers in the network controller, wherein matching criteria, in received network packets, and/or corresponding actions that may be performed in matching packets, may be specified. The matching criteria may comprise specifying one or more header types that may be utilized in the received network packets. The network controller may generate filter identifiers, which may be utilized, subsequently, via the management controller to delete the packet filters. | 10-23-2008 |
20080282328 | METHOD AND SYSTEM FOR MODELING OPTIONS FOR OPAQUE MANAGEMENT DATA FOR A USER AND/OR AN OWNER - Distributed Management Task Force (DMTF) management profiles, based on the Common Information Model (CIM) protocol, may be utilized to perform access authentication during opaque management data profile operations based on DMTF/CIM Role Based Authorization (RBA) profile and/or Simple Identity Management (SIM) profiles. Instances of CIM_Identity class may be utilized to enable validation of ownership and/or access rights, via instances of CIM_Role class and/or instances of CIM_Privilege class for a plurality of common users and/or applications. Quota related operations may be performed via “QuotaAffectsElement” associations between instances of CIM_Identity class and instances of the CIM_OpaqueManagementDataService class. The “QuotaAffectsElement” association may comprise “AllocationQuota” and/or “AllocatedBytes” properties to enable tracking and/or validating of quota related information within the opaque management data profile. | 11-13-2008 |
20090178104 | METHOD AND SYSTEM FOR A MULTI-LEVEL SECURITY ASSOCIATION LOOKUP SCHEME FOR INTERNET PROTOCOL SECURITY - Methods and systems for data communication are disclosed and may include utilizing a multi-level lookup process for determining IPsec parameters from a security association database. The security association database may be stored in content addressable memory, and may include an Internet protocol address table, a security association lookup table, and a security association context table. The security association lookup and security association context tables may include a single table. An Internet protocol address table index may be looked up in the Internet protocol address table for a first lookup of the multi-level lookup process. A security protocol index may be looked up utilizing the Internet protocol address table index for a second lookup of the multi-level lookup process. The Internet protocol security parameters may be determined utilizing the security protocol index. IPsec processing may be performed utilizing the determined Internet protocol security parameters. | 07-09-2009 |
20100005190 | METHOD AND SYSTEM FOR A NETWORK CONTROLLER BASED PASS-THROUGH COMMUNICATION MECHANISM BETWEEN LOCAL HOST AND MANAGEMENT CONTROLLER - A network controller in a communication device may be operable to route local host-management traffic between a local host and a management controller within the communication device, wherein the local host may be operable to utilize its network processing resources and function during communication of the local host-management traffic. A dedicated management port may be configured in the network controller to enable receiving and/or transmitting local host-management traffic communicated from and/or to the local host separate from the local host's network traffic communicated via the network controller. The host-management traffic is communicated between the network controller and the management controller via NC-SI interface. The management controller may be assigned Internet protocol (IP) based addressing information for use during routing of local host-management traffic. The IP addressing information may be preset statically, assigned automatically from a list of available addresses, or configured dynamically via a DHCP server function. | 01-07-2010 |
20100192218 | METHOD AND SYSTEM FOR PACKET FILTERING FOR LOCAL HOST-MANAGEMENT CONTROLLER PASS-THROUGH COMMUNICATION VIA NETWORK CONTROLLER - A network controller in a communication device may be operable to provide pass-through communication of local host-management traffic between a local host and a management controller within the communication device, wherein the local host may be operable to utilize its network processing resources during communication of the local host-management traffic. The network controller may use packet filtering to provide the pass-through communication, wherein the network controller may utilize a plurality filtering rules during filtering of packets received in the network controller. The filtering rules may specify packet processing and/or forwarding actions by said network controller based on one or more specified conditions. The specified conditions may based on one or more match criteria; wherein the match criteria comprising source address, destination address, and/or traffic type data in the received packets. Address learning mechanisms may be used in the network controller to enable configuring and/or performing packet filtering transparently. | 07-29-2010 |
20110029650 | METHOD AND SYSTEM FOR HOST INDEPENDENT PLATFORM DIAGNOSTICS - A management controller in a network device may provide host-independent diagnostics servicing corresponding to a plurality of managed resources in the network devices. The management controller may be integrated into a network controller in the network device. The diagnostics servicing may be based on one or more management protocols, such as the Web Service Management (WS-Management) protocol. The management controller may log diagnostic data and/or alerts corresponding to the managed resources. The management controller may communicate with the managed resource to request and/or receive the diagnostic data and/or alerts, using Platform Level Data Model (PLDM) based interactions for example. The management controller may incorporate diagnostics based management interface for use during diagnostics management servicing, to exchange diagnostics related management messaging with management devices and/or entities. The diagnostics based management interface may be implemented using Common Information Model (CIM) objects. | 02-03-2011 |
20110029659 | Method and System for Network Proxy Services for Energy Efficient Networking - A network device may provide power-aware network proxy services to one or more resources internal to the network device and/or one or more other network devices that may transition to corresponding power saving states. The power saving states may comprise disabling, shutting down, and/or reducing power consumption. The power-aware network proxy service may comprise handling at least some of network communication on behalf of serviced internal resources and/or other network devices, and monitoring for conditions to transition the serviced internal resources and/or other network devices from the corresponding power saving states. The power-aware network proxy services may be provided via a network interface controller (NIC) in the network device. Determining when to transition serviced resources and/or other network devices from corresponding power saving states may be based on monitoring and/or processing of traffic handled on behalf of the serviced resources and/or other network devices during power-aware network proxy servicing. | 02-03-2011 |
20110032944 | Method and System for Switching in a Virtualized Platform - A local manager in a local networking domain may configure a plurality of logical switches by combining switching functions available in network devices and/or network switches in the local networking domain. The configuration may utilize vertical and/or horizontal combinations of the switching functions. The switching functions may comprise network switch-based switching functions, and/or hypervisor-level switching functions and/or network adapter-level switching functions available in network devices which may be configured as virtualized platforms. The local manager may provide interfacing services to enable exposing configured logical switches. The interfacing services may comprise an internal interface, which may be utilized, via the local manager, to control the switching functions corresponding to logical switches and/or to route messages sent to and/or from the logical switches. The interfacing services may also comprise an external interface, which may be used by external entities, such as remote management entities, to manage and/or interact with configured logical switches. | 02-10-2011 |
20110035474 | METHOD AND SYSTEM FOR MATCHING AND REPAIRING NETWORK CONFIGURATION - Aspects of a method and system for matching and repairing network configuration are provided. In this regard, one or more circuits and/or processors may be operable to determine a configuration of one or more parameters in a plurality of devices along a network path, and detect whether any of the one or more parameters are configured such that communication between the plurality of devices is disabled and/or suboptimal. The devices may comprise at least one server and one or more of a network switch, a network bridge, and a router. In instances that one or more parameters are incompatibly or sub-optimally configured, a notification of the incompatibility may be communicated to a network management entity and/or one or more messages may be generated to reconfigure the one or more parameters in one or more of the plurality of devices. The determining and/or detecting may be performed automatically in response to various events. | 02-10-2011 |
20110035498 | Method and System for Managing Network Power Policy and Configuration of Data Center Bridging - Certain aspects of a method and system for managing network power policy and configuration of data center bridging may include a network domain that comprises a single logical point of management (LPM) that coordinates operation of one or more devices, such as network interface controllers (NICs), switches, and/or servers in the network domain: The single LPM may be operable to manage one or both of a network power policy and/or a data center bridging (DCB) configuration policy for the network domain. | 02-10-2011 |
20110106943 | Host Independent Secondary Application Processor - A system for providing a secondary processing environment to a computer system having a host processor includes a secondary processor configured to perform a processing service, a policy manager configured to control interaction between the secondary processor and the host processor, a service provider configured to provide the processing service to the computer system and a host-state monitor to monitor state of the host processor, wherein the secondary processor operation is based on the state of the host processor. | 05-05-2011 |
20110106977 | METHOD AND SYSTEM FOR HOST INDEPENDENT SECONDARY APPLICATION PROCESSOR - A network interface controller (NIC) in a computer device may provide host-independent secondary processing servicing. The secondary processing servicing may be provided by the NIC independent of networking operations performed by NIC, and may comprise performing applications and/or services typically performed in the computer device. The secondary processing servicing may be provided, and/or be activated when an operating system (OS), a virtual machine (VM), a service, and/or an application running in the computer device becomes unavailable, due to transitions to non-active and/or low-power or power saving states. In instances where the computer device is configured as a virtualized platform, comprising a plurality of VMs, the secondary processing servicing may be provided separately and/or independently to each of the plurality of VMs running in the computer device during the virtualization. The secondary processing servicing may be provided using a dedicated component in the NIC, which may be fixed or removable. | 05-05-2011 |
20110276625 | METHOD AND SYSTEM FOR HOST INDEPENDENT KEYBOARD, VIDEO, AND MOUSE (KVM) REDIRECTION - A management controller in a network device may provide and/or support host-independent keyboard, video, and mouse (KVM) redirection operations in the network device. The management controller may be integrated into a network controller in the network device. The management controller may enable routing of KVM redirection related interactions between the network device and remote KVM peers, with KVM redirection related functions and/or operations being performed and/or provided by other components in the network device. The management controller may also implement a KVM protocol stack utilized in providing peer-to-peer KVM redirection connectivity and/or communications, and/or invoking KVM services in the network device. The management controller may also directly provide and/or perform at least a portion of the KVM services. The management controller may utilize during host-independent KVM redirection, keyboard driver, mouse driver, and/or graphics driver in a basic input/output system (BIOS) of the network device. | 11-10-2011 |
20110292807 | METHOD AND SYSTEM FOR SIDEBAND COMMUNICATION ARCHITECTURE FOR SUPPORTING MANAGEABILITY OVER WIRELESS LAN (WLAN) - A management controller in a network device may support performing management operations based on management traffic communicated wirelessly via a wireless network controller of the network devices. The management controller may perform the management operations and/or to support wireless communication of the management traffic independent of operations of the network device. The management controller may be integrated into a network controller in the network device. The management traffic may comprise out-of-band (OOB) management related traffic. A direct interface may be established between the management controller and the wireless network controller, to support direct sideband communication between the management controller and the wireless network controller. The sideband interface may incorporate Network Controller Sideband Interface (NC-SI) and/or Secure Digital Input Output (SDIO) interface. The management controller may control operations of the wireless network controller, by utilizing an embedded wireless controller driver. | 12-01-2011 |
20120016970 | Method and System for Network Configuration and/or Provisioning Based on Open Virtualization Format (OVF) Metadata - Certain aspects of a method and system for network configuration and/or provisioning based on open virtualization format (OVF) metadata may include accessing a set of port profiles for one or more virtual machines from a port profile database based on OVF metadata. One or more virtual machines may be configured, deployed, and/or managed based on the accessed set of port profiles. One or both of a uniform resource identifier (URI) to the profile data base and/or a port profile identification may be included in the OVF metadata to allow a virtual machine (VM) administrator device to access the set of port profiles for the one or more virtual machines from the port profile database. Alternatively, the set of port profiles may be included in the OVF metadata to allow the VM administrator device to access the set of port profiles for the one or more virtual machines from the port profile database. | 01-19-2012 |
20130031236 | Method and System for Platform Level Data Model for Indications Based Event Control and Data Transfer - For a platform level data model for indications based event control and data transfer, a management controller may enable performing indications based management operations that may be based on a management service utilizing CIM Indications model. The management controller may enable communication of indications based messaging and/or data. The indications may be triggered based on events generated and/or triggered in a plurality of managed entities. The events generation may be performed dynamically within the plurality of managed entities, or may be initiated via the management controller. The management controller may enable processing of partially generated indications, via the plurality of managed entities, and/or as pass-through router for full indications processed via the plurality of managed entities. The indications based management operations may also comprise subscription related operations wherein the management controller may enable performing processing of subscription requests, modifications, and/or deletions to facilitate external access via the device. | 01-31-2013 |
20130124702 | Method and System For Network Configuration And/Or Provisioning Based On Metadata - Disclosed are various embodiments for configuring a virtual machine. A template for a virtual machine may be generated. The template may include metadata that references data for port profiles for the virtual machine. The template for the virtual machine may be stored in a template repository, and the data for the port profiles may be stored in a port profile database that is separate from the template. | 05-16-2013 |
20130125216 | METHOD AND SYSTEM FOR MODELING OPTIONS FOR OPAQUE MANAGEMENT DATA FOR A USER AND/OR AN OWNER - Distributed Management Task Force (DMTF) management profiles, based on the Common Information Model (CIM) protocol, may be utilized to perform access authentication during opaque management data profile operations based on DMTF/CIM Role Based Authorization (RBA) profile and/or Simple Identity Management (SIM) profiles. Instances of CIM_Identity class may be utilized to enable validation of ownership and/or access rights, via instances of CIM_Role class and/or instances of CIM_Privilege class for a plurality of common users and/or applications. Quota related operations may be performed via “QuotaAffectsElement” associations between instances of CIM_Identity class and instances of the CIM_OpaqueManagementDataService class. The “QuotaAffectsElement” association may comprise “AllocationQuota” and/or “AllocatedBytes” properties to enable tracking and/or validating of quota related information within the opaque management data profile. | 05-16-2013 |
20130132951 | Network Port Profile Representation in Open Virtualization Format Package - A method for providing network port profiles in open virtualization format includes embedding content of the network port profiles in an open virtualization format file, referencing the network port profiles inside an open virtualization format package, or referencing the network port profiles outside of the OVF package. | 05-23-2013 |
20130132952 | Network Port Profile Deployment in a Pre-Provisioned or Dynamically Provisioned Network Infrastructure - A system for open virtualization format includes a virtualization platform to run a virtual machine and a network infrastructure to accommodate the virtualization platform. The network infrastructure includes a deployed network port profile associated with the virtual machine. | 05-23-2013 |
20130262604 | METHOD AND SYSTEM FOR MATCHING AND REPAIRING NETWORK CONFIGURATION - Aspects of a method and system for matching and repairing network configuration are provided. In this regard, one or more circuits and/or processors may be operable to determine a configuration of one or more parameters in a plurality of devices along a network path, and detect whether any of the one or more parameters are configured such that communication between the plurality of devices is disabled and/or suboptimal. The devices may comprise at least one server and one or more of a network switch, a network bridge, and a router. In instances that one or more parameters are incompatibly or sub-optimally configured, a notification of the incompatibility may be communicated to a network management entity and/or one or more messages may be generated to reconfigure the one or more parameters in one or more of the plurality of devices. The determining and/or detecting may be performed automatically in response to various events. | 10-03-2013 |
20130297787 | Method And System For Managing Network Power Policy And Configuration Of Data Center Bridging - Certain aspects of a method and system for managing network power policy and configuration of data center bridging may include a network domain that comprises a single logical point of management (LPM) that coordinates operation of one or more devices, such as network interface controllers (NICs), switches, and/or servers in the network domain: The single LPM may be operable to manage one or both of a network power policy and/or a data center bridging (DCB) configuration policy for the network domain. | 11-07-2013 |
20130326039 | Network Controller With Integrated Management Controller - An network controller provides both network controller and management controller functionality. Accordingly, the system host sees, in a single device, both network functionality as well as management functionality. The integration may reduce chip count and provide a more cost effective as well as power efficient platform solution for the network and management functions in a larger system, such as a server with multiple network controllers and multiple network ports. | 12-05-2013 |